A/c Maintenance
Regular maintenance keeps your cooling system running effectively. Our expert HVAC specialists perform extensive maintenance services that consist of:
- Cleaning or changing air filters
- Checking refrigerant levels
-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
- Inspecting and cleaning up drain lines
- Inspecting electrical connections
- Lubing moving parts
- Checking thermostat operation
- Verifying correct air flow

Heating Unit Maintenance
Regular maintenance prevents numerous he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our expert HVAC contractors perform thorough maintenance services that include:
-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
- Checking combustion performance
- Testing safety controls
- Cleaning up or changing filters
- Examining electrical connections
- Lubricating moving parts
- Cleaning burners and adjusting the flame

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Restricted air flow makes your system work more difficult and minimizes convenience. Our HVAC specialists determine airflow issues, whether caused by duct problems, filthy filters, or fan problems.
- Unequal Heating or Cooling
If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ation concerns,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can diagnose these problems and suggest options.
- Brief Cycling
When your system switches on and off frequently, it wastes energy and wears out components quicker. Our HVAC professionals can determine whether the problem stems from a clogged fil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more severe.
- High Energy Bills
Unexpected boosts in energy bills typically suggest HVAC ineffectiveness. Our specialists carry out energy performance evaluations to identify the cause and recommend enhancements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ems should help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summertime or too dry in winter season, our HVAC specialists can advise services to enhance convenience and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
Often what appears like a system failure is in fact a thermostat problem. Our HVAC professionals can fix or change thermostats and help you update to programmable or smart models for better convenience control and energy cost savings.
